Algebraic Models For Accounting Systems
Nehmer, Robert A (Oakland Univ, Usa)
Describes the construction of algebraic models which represent the operations of the double-entry accounting system. This book presents a comprehensive treatment of the subject and utilizes the methods and tools of abstract algebra, including automata, graph theory and monoids.
